Viewers of Coronation Street have seen Stephen go to any lengths to make sure his plans to obtain Audrey’s money are carried out. It appears that his plan will finally be realized in upcoming episodes with the aid of his estranged wife.
ITV soap opera viewers watched in horror as Leo Thompkins (Joe Frost) was killed last month when Stephen Reid (Todd Boyce) threatened to expose his lies and then threw him over the edge of a two-story building. The citizens of Weatherfield mistakenly believe Stephen simply left town after disposing of the body. The Canadian businessman launches his final scheme to defraud his mother Audrey knowing that no one will find out why he wants Audrey’s money.
After killing Leo in retaliation for threatening to reveal him to the family, the Coronation Street resident became the newest villain of the ITV soap opera.
He overheard a conversation between Stephen and his estranged ex-partner Gabrielle about how he intended to make up for the money he had stolen from her in the past.
Leo discovered that he was trying to get his mother, Audrey Roberts (Sue Nicholls), to list her house in order to steal the equity and use it to repay Gabrielle.
However, when he confronted him and said he would explain his plan to the family and then the police, Stephen grew angry and pushed him over the two-story building, where he died.
The residents of Coronation Street assumed the conman had fled to Canada alone after disposing of the body, but scenes slated for broadcast next week may reveal otherwise.
Leo’s father Teddy Thompkins (Grant Burgin) and his partner Jenny Connor (Sally Ann Matthews) decide to meet up at the Bistro to discuss finding him as they grow concerned that they haven’t heard from him.
Stephen takes a picture of them together on Leo’s phone that he took after the murder and sends it to Teddy out of concern that they’ll learn the truth.
Stephen poses as the deceased and requests that they not get in touch with him again while claiming that the photo of them both was sent to him by a friend.
To Stephen’s horror, Teddy is not persuaded when he says he’s going to Canada to meet with his son in person.
Later, when Stephen is running out of patience, his ex-wife Gabrielle confronts him and demands the money she is owed.
When his mother gives him her phone and requests that the notifications be turned off because they are driving her crazy, the conman can’t believe his good fortune.
He meets Gabrielle and tells her that he is waiting for the mortgage broker to call Audrey’s phone so that she can pose as her and get the money back.
He tells Gail that it might be time for him to leave now that Audrey is feeling better while trying to plan his exit because he knows there’s a good chance he’ll get equity release money.
When Sam’s mother suggests staying at one of his properties in Canada to see the Northern Lights, it throws a wrench in the plan.
In a panic, Stephen tries to stop their travel plans by persuading Gail that Audrey shouldn’t travel to Canada because the weather will be too severe.
Instead, he suggests that she take a cruise in Norway, and even offers to make all the arrangements to make sure nothing interferes with his plans.
